Generated always column sql server
WebMar 18, 2024 · The Computed construct allows a Column to be declared in DDL as a “GENERATED ALWAYS AS” column, that is, one which has a value that is computed by the database server. The construct accepts a SQL expression typically declared textually using a string or the text() construct, in a similar manner as that of CheckConstraint . WebNov 22, 2016 · Cannot insert an explicit value into a GENERATED ALWAYS column in table '.dbo.. Use INSERT with a column list to exclude the GENERATED ALWAYS column, or insert a DEFAULT into GENERATED ALWAYS column. It looks like EF is trying to update the values of the PERIOD columns which …
Generated always column sql server
Did you know?
WebDec 4, 2024 · GO ALTER TABLE InsurancePolicy ADD SysStartTime DATETIME2 GENERATED ALWAYS AS ROW START HIDDEN CONSTRAINT DF_SysStart … WebMar 13, 2024 · This worked on SQL Server and Azure SQL (PaaS) environment. ALTER TABLE [dbo].[AnalysisCustomRollupsV2JoinGroups] ADD SysStartTime datetime2(0) GENERATED ALWAYS AS ...
WebSep 13, 2016 · CREATE TABLE [dbo].[ATMs] ( [StartTime] DATETIME2 (2) GENERATED ALWAYS AS ROW START NOT NULL CONSTRAINT [DF_M360_ATMs_StartTime] … WebMar 3, 2024 · 1 = Column has a non-SQL Server subscriber. is_merge_published: bit: 1 = Column is merge-published. is_dts_replicated: bit: 1 = Column is replicated by using SSIS. ... Identifies when the column value is generated (will always be 0 for columns in system tables): 0 = NOT_APPLICABLE 1 = AS_ROW_START 2 = AS_ROW_END 7 = …
WebJul 9, 2024 · Cannot insert an explicit value into a GENERATED ALWAYS column in table 'my.table'. Use INSERT with a column list to exclude the GENERATED ALWAYS column, or insert a DEFAULT into GENERATED ALWAYS column. Note that the hint lies. The default seems to not be used. Here is a fiddle presenting the problem. WebOct 26, 2015 · You will need to replace WHERE 1 = 1 in two places above to select your data, also change TableName to the name of your table and it currently puts NULL as …
WebJun 3, 2024 · This syntax uses the GENERATED ALWAYS column-constraint. The GENERATED ALWAYS part is optional in SQLite, so you could just use AS. Actually, …
WebHow to insert current time into a timestamp with SQL Server: In newer versions of SQL Server, timestamp is renamed to RowVersion. Rightly so, because timestamp name is … cushion hub kitsWebFeb 28, 2024 · In this article. This article describes the reason why SQL Server Migration Assistant (SSMA) for DB2 adds ROWID column to the table, if there are triggers.. … chase products incWebJan 11, 2024 · The difference matters only if you pass a value rather than let a value be generated. Typically, people always rely on the generated value, so normally you would simply use the first version, GENERATED BY DEFAULT AS IDENTITY. GENERATED BY DEFAULT AS IDENTITY. Generates a value unless the INSERT command provides a … cushion hude away foot stoolWebDec 29, 2024 · The TYPE COLUMN in the table holding the document type information of the column. ID of the full-text TYPE COLUMN for the column name expression passed as the second parameter of this function. GeneratedAlwaysType: Is column value system-generated. Corresponds to sys.columns.generated_always_type: Applies to: SQL … cushion hug meaningWebJan 16, 2024 · Seems like it's a problem with SQL Server itself, but I wanted to post it here to confirm. Attempting to set a non-NULL-able column's value to NULL. The target table must be versioned; The history table must have a non-clustered index ... Number INT NOT NULL, ValidFrom DATETIME2 GENERATED ALWAYS AS ROW START, ValidTo … cushion in frenchWebJul 4, 2016 · The GENERATED ALWAYS AS ROW START column represents the time when the row data became current, basically on an INSERT/UPDATE of the record in … cushion in cushion out animationWebNov 9, 2024 · All other fields can store nulls so even if nothing was submitted and I would think id should be generated for the new column. But for some reason it is not working. ... Most database developers and administrators that work with Microsoft SQL Server prefer camel case for table and column names, as opposed to using the underscores approach … cushion infills ikea